And to answer Becky’s question about why we waited so long to get married, well to us we didn’t really consider it waiting.  We were together and that’s what was important to us.  If we got married, that’s cool.  And if we didn’t, that’s cool too.  However, we did eventually come to realize the benefits of becoming a legally recognized couple.  If we weren’t married and something happened to either one of us, we would not be considered next of kin.  If something were to happen and one of us had to stay in the hospital for  an extended amount of time, we might not be given information or provided with visitation rights because we were not a legal couple.  This concerned us and we decided that it was in our best interest to get married. So we did!  I realize how unromantic that sounds but that’s our story. :D
